    The short answer

    LASIK in Australia or the UK costs $4,000-$8,000 for both eyes. Malaysia offers the same laser platforms at $1,600-$3,600. For inbound medical tourists, LASIK in Malaysia is feasible if you can stay for the critical first-week follow-up. For Malaysian residents, there is no reason to travel.

    Safety, regulation, and what happens if something goes wrong

    Both Malaysia and Australia / UK regulate medical procedures through national health authorities, with licensed clinics, board-certified practitioners and accreditation standards. The real differentiator isn't the rule book — it's what happens after you walk out the door.

    The aftercare reality

    Australian and UK patients considering LASIK in Malaysia should plan a minimum 7-10 day stay to cover surgery and the critical day-1 and week-1 follow-ups. Subsequent follow-ups can be coordinated with a local optometrist.

    Where Australia / UK genuinely excels

    Australia and the UK have the most comprehensive regulatory frameworks for refractive surgery, with mandatory informed consent processes and outcome reporting.
